How far people went at school, the qualifications they hold and what they studied.
Fewer people have completed high school in Pelican Point compared to most areas, with only 31.6% finishing Year 12. This is far below both the state and national figures, reflecting a community where many adults left school early.
Highest year of school completed.
Only 31.6% of residents finished Year 12, which is far below the South Australian figure of 54.6%. About 25% of people here left school in Year 9 or earlier.

Post-school qualifications and degrees.
The proportion of adults with a bachelor degree or higher is 13.1%, well below the state average. Most qualified residents hold a Certificate III or IV, which is the most common qualification at 38.6%.

What people studied.
Among those with qualifications, the most common fields are health at 22.7% and engineering at 20.5%. Architecture and building make up a further 13.6%.
